About Madrid to Cali Flights
Flights from Madrid (MAD) to Cali (CLO) cover a distance of approximately 8,303 kilometers. A direct flight typically takes around 11 hours and 23 minutes, based on an average cruising speed of 800 km/h and including time for takeoff and landing procedures.
Adolfo Suárez Madrid–Barajas Airport in Spain and Alfonso Bonilla Aragón International Airport in Colombia are located in different time zones. Cali is approximately 5 hours behind Madrid.
This flight route produces an estimated 955 kg of CO₂ per passenger, based on industry average emissions calculations.
